As part of Thames Water’s major projects work, a new final effluent pumping station was required at the Crossness Sewage Treatment Works (STW), helping to cope with higher river levels. Our temporary groundworks solutions were called upon to facilitate this work.

The challenge

Complex excavation

The largely below-ground design of the new pumping station required robust groundworks support to safely manage high earth pressures and ensure a stable working environment.

Alignment and installation issues

Previously installed sheet piles were found to be out of alignment once excavation began, requiring rapid redesign and adaptation of the temporary works to accommodate on-site discrepancies.

Contractor coordination

Seamless integration was needed between Mabey Hire, the principal contractor, and MAL Contractors to align the temporary works design with construction sequencing and resolve issues quickly to avoid project delays.

Our solution

To ensure the safe construction of the new below-ground effluent pumping station at Crossness STW, Mabey Hire designed and supplied a comprehensive groundworks support package for MAL Contractors. Given the significant excavation depth, the solution utilised high-capacity Super Bracing Struts (SBS 600 range) and Supershaft Plus systems to provide robust lateral support and maintain excavation stability.

This combination allowed the MAL team to safely work within the deep pit while supporting the heavy ground loads surrounding the site. The equipment was straightforward to install, and thanks to early coordination with the principal contractor, the transition to on-site operations was smooth and efficient.

As works progressed, unexpected issues arose, including misaligned sheet piles installed by a previous contractor. Mabey Hire quickly redesigned sections of the trench wall to include additional welds and supplied an 18-metre replacement beam to overcome installation challenges.

This responsive design adaptation minimised disruption and kept the project on schedule. The collaborative relationship between Mabey Hire and MAL Contractors ensured the temporary works were executed safely, efficiently, and with minimal delay—supporting the successful delivery of the new pumping station while maintaining the highest safety standards on site.
